Action item from the Crumbwell outage: the order-cutoff rule (no next-day cake orders after 2pm) was hardcoded in three places, and they drifted. We're consolidating it into one config flag in the Ovenline service — that's your task. Don't just grep and delete; the storefront caches the cutoff for an hour. Steps, gotchas, and the rollout checklist are all written up on the internal wiki page.

wiki page, hahif-hahif: https://argocd.kelvisys.corp/browse/board/settings/pages/1442e0b1065d83f1

## CI Note: Farelane Pricing Experiment Failures

If the Farelane ticket-pricing experiment suite fails on your first runs, don't panic — it's usually a provenance mismatch, not your code. The experiment flags are baked into the build at stamp time, so a locally assembled binary will disagree with the fixture data. Rebuild through the Marrowgate pipeline and rerun. When asking for help in the channel, always quote the stamped trace token, reproduced below.

pipeline stamp: htk31_f769b577b3028a4e9958e5bb8d1259a

Subject: Handover — Orlix ORM refactor

Hi Derven,

Taking over from me tonight: the legacy Orlix ORM layer is mid-refactor. Session factories now live in the new adapter module; old mappers are deprecated but still active for billing tables. Don't touch migration 042 until the queue drains. If the replica lags, point the adapter at the staging primary using the following connection string.

replica DSN, yahaf-yagaf: mongodb://tamath_svc:a2netSk3RZMuTj@db-d084.novacsoft.internal:5432/ralmir

## Sensor drift: what to do at 3am

If the GrowLoop controller starts reporting humidity swings that don't match the backup probes in the Fernwick greenhouse, it's almost always sensor drift, not an actual climate event. Don't panic and don't touch the vents manually. First, restart the calibration daemon and give it ten minutes to re-baseline. If readings still disagree by more than 5%, flip the controller into safe mode. The safe-mode thresholds it will use are these.

config for yahap-bajof:
[istix]
host = istix.qorvelsys.internal
user = istix_svc
database = istix_prod